The boys are back and talking in depth about people walking. We discuss the book "The Long Walk" and how we are excited for the movie to come out. We also talk about "Novocaine" that is streaming on Paramount+. Julian gives a very passionate review on "28 Years Later". Of course we couldn't go without talking about season 3 of "Squid Game".
